What Is Pod-Stick and Why Does It Matter Now?

Pod-sticking agents are applied in late-season to oilseed rape (OSR), beans, and peas to:
Reduce pod shatter losses
Protect against harvest-time weather variability
Help pods dry more uniformly, making timing easier
With increasingly unpredictable weather and higher input costs, losing 10–20% of your crop to pod shatter isn’t just inconvenient — it’s expensive.

Why Use Drones for Pod-Stick Application?
Traditional sprayers bring downsides:
Tramline loss right before harvest
Risk of physical pod damage from booms or wheelings
Time sensitivity that can be hard to meet in tight windows
Potential mismatch with ELM scheme requirements on reduced compaction
